His Majesty grants Land Kidu to 6,718 households in Zhemgang

His Majesty The King granted landKiduto 6,718 households including those who were eligible for land substitution in Zhemgang on 16th September 2014 in Zhemgang The Kidu is part of His Majesty’s ongoing Land Reform across the country. JAB study finds poor state of Media in Bhutan

A Journalists Association of Bhutan (JAB) study on the situational assessment of Journalists in Bhutan showed that the current media situation in the country is ‘very bad.’ The survey covered 90 journalists working in 16 media organizations and 29 former journalists. Supreme Court Judge Honoured by Law College in Delhi

Supreme Court Judge, Justice Rinzin Penjor of the Maja (Peacock) bench was honoured by the Campus Law Center in Delhi University with the Distinguished Alumnus award on 12th August.
